We have an immediate opening for: Team Foundation Server Specialist
Location: NYC, NY
Duration: 6+ months contract
Job Description:
Analysis and Recommendation
· Meet with developers and non-technical stakeholders to understand our current software development processes, technology stacks, development tools
· Meet with management and other consultants to understand our desired future-state processes
· Identify common processes shared by different areas of the organization, or which could be shared, while also documenting specific requirements unique to individual development teams
· Recommend templates, tools, project layouts/configurations, and other out-of-the box features that can accommodate both common processes and area-specific requirements
· Identify gaps with what TFS provides out of the box and provide/recommend solutions
· Meet with other TR development teams to evaluate their TFS implementations and identify how to leverage/reuse any components or customizations made in other TR teams
· Create a TFS Architecture and Platform Implementation that allows for common, shared processes as well as area-specific requirements
· Identify tools to allow integration of TFS with non-Microsoft and non-Windows IDEs and development tools
Migration
· Plan and Execute TFS Migration, including the migration of existing TFS projects to the new project layout and the preservation of existing work items, stories, tasks, and other project artifacts
· Plan and execute migration from other SDLC management systems (specifically VersionOne and Jira) to TFS, while preserving existing work items, stories, tasks and other project artifact
Process
· Current development process analysis
· Recommend process improvements
Custom Tools
· Create build scripts and configuration management
· Develop custom reports and templates
· Meet with management to understand requirements for reporting and metrics, and design custom reports to meet those needs
· Create tools and components to increase TFS functionality and better integrate with our internal processes
· Work item customization
Training
· Develops training materials, and offers training sessions for developers as well as non-technical team members on best practices for using and administering TFS
EXPERIENCE
· Minimum of five years working with TFS as a team leader or configuration manager, and deep experience in working with development teams to define SDLC processes and TFS implementations
· Deep familiarity with multiple development tools and integrating those tools with TFS
· Strong business analysis skills, including the ability to discuss technical issues with non-technical staff
· Deep familiarity with multiple development methodologies, including waterfall (CMM), RUP, eXtreme, Scrum, and other "agile" methods
